After wildfires, structure fires, or other combustion events, surfaces and indoor environments can accumulate fire-related debris. Combustion Particle Analysis helps distinguish these particles from normal dust and background materials, giving you objective data to support environmental assessments, remediation verification, or legal documentation. 

Common sources of combustion particles include: wildfire smoke intrusion, structure fires, post-remediation dust, and unusual residue complaints.
